Obituary for Paul A. Prekop Sr.

Paul A.  Prekop Sr.
Paul A. Prekop, Sr., 84, of Brick, NJ who loved to fish made his last cast on earth, passing away on September 20, 2016. He was the son of Woodbridge Fire Chief, John J. Prekop and mother, Elizabeth. He grew up on Old Grove Avenue in Woodbridge, NJ. Paul graduated from Woodbridge High School having a love of woodworking and enjoyed working with his hands! He proudly served his country in the US National Guard in Sea Girt, NJ. Paul’s career was a Millwright for Rheem Manufacturing in Linden, NJ. He was a volunteer Firefighter with the Sayreville Fire Department, loved Monmouth Park Race Track, Ballroom Dancing, fishing on the Gambler in Point Pleasant Beach and feeding the seagulls at the Manasquan Inlet. In the 1990’s, Paul and his wife, Carolyn relocated to Florida where Paul helped his community build a Veterans Memorial and raised funds for various charities.
Paul’s passing was preceded by his loving wife, Carolyn V. Prekop, of 55 years; and brother, John Prekop.
Paul is survived by his sister, Mary Bakos of Brick, NJ and his son Paul Prekop, Jr., and his wife, Terry and granddaughter, Alexis Smith, and her husband, Lance; grandson, Paul Prekop, III and two grandchildren, Haylee Elizabeth and Jarett James of Las Vegas, NV; his daughter, Kimberly A. Potter, and her husband, Craig of Manasquan, NJ; granddaughter, Lindsay A. Jones, and her boyfriend, Matt Majkotoski of Brick, NJ; and his beloved dance partner, Joan Mitryk. Paul will be dearly missed.
